Ripples in Spacetime: Unlocking the Secrets of Gravitational Waves

In this episode of Cosmos in a Pod, we explore one of the most groundbreaking discoveries of modern astrophysics: gravitational waves. These ripples in spacetime, predicted by Einstein over a century ago, offer a new way to observe the universe’s most dramatic events. Key Highlights:

  • What Are Gravitational Waves?
    • Discover how gravitational waves are formed by events like merging black holes and neutron star collisions.
    • Understand their nature as ripples in spacetime travelling at the speed of light.
  • Einstein’s Legacy and the First Detection:
    • Learn about Einstein’s 1915 prediction of gravitational waves and their historic detection by LIGO in 2015.
    • Explore the groundbreaking science behind the Laser Interferometer Gravitational-Wave Observatory.
  • What Gravitational Waves Teach Us:
    • Black hole mergers and the creation of heavy elements in neutron star collisions.
    • Insights into the early universe and tests of Einstein’s General Theory of Relativity in extreme conditions.
  • The Challenges of Detection:
    • Gravitational waves cause distortions on scales smaller than a proton’s width.
    • Global collaborations with observatories like LIGO, Virgo, and upcoming space-based missions like LISA.
  • The Future of Gravitational Wave Astronomy:
    • Next-generation detectors expanding our reach to supermassive black hole mergers and primordial waves.
    • The promise of multi-messenger astronomy, combining gravitational waves with electromagnetic signals.
  • Unanswered Questions:
    • Can gravitational waves uncover the mysteries of black hole singularities?
    • What can primordial waves reveal about the first moments of the universe?
